I was just wondering if the new HDTV locals also use the spot beam as the regular locals do or if they are all national? I just ask because I picked up the new AT9 dish. I really wanted to do the dish install myself. I followed the directions carefully. At first I thought I was having trouble because I forgot to attatch the filter to the receiver. I have great signal strength on the main birds. The other ones either show nothing or a couple of the transponders show up with a great signal.

It was getting dark and cold out so I didn't want to fool around with it too much. I was just wondering though if I should get a signal on all of the new sats and transponders or if it is like the other where some are high and some are very low or don't even register. My standard locals all come in fine, it's just my HDTV versions that give me a searching for signal. Thanks guys.

you will note get a signal on all the sat's(99).
 
I am going to fine tune it later today. I think I must be close to it as I am getting signals on one of the new sats. But if I read right, those cover nationally, no spot beams? Thanks again guys.
 
To answer the original question; MPEG4 HD LIL will be spot beamed just like current LIL. AND my guess they will be much tighter beams. Outside of the core stuff, only the DNS is CONUS.
